Present ADVENTURES IN HARMONY “Young Women’s Edition” September 28, 2016 7:30 pm Zeeland High Auditorium This activity is made possible by the Barbershop Harmony Society, underwritten in part by Harmony Foundation International and its generous donors Sandra Snow, Michigan State University Professor of Choral Conducting and Music Education As conductor, teacher, and scholar, Sandra Snow’s work spans a wide variety of ages, abilities, and music. She holds appointments in conducting and music education at the MSU College of Music, where she interacts with undergraduate and graduate students in the areas of conducting, choral pedagogy, and choral singing. As guest conductor, she travels extensively conducting all-state and honor choirs and holding residencies with singers of all ages. EXPERIENCE THE ENERGY! 250 young women from six area high schools plus women from the Holland Chorale and Hope College acapella group Luminescence will spend the day singing together and learning from clinician Sandra Snow. At 7:30 p.m. that evening they will present a concert for the public. Admission is free but free-will donations will be gratefully accepted. and
